#3deccc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3deccc is composed of 23.9% red, 92.5%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.6%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 169 degrees, a saturation of 82.2% and a lightness of 58.2%. #3deccc color hex could be obtained by blending #7affff with #00d999.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#3deccc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3deccc has RGB values of R:61, G:236,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 4058316.

Shades and Tints of #3deccc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#f0f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#3deccc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9a98 is the less saturated color, while #2dfcd6 is the most saturated one.
